Anyone who monitors this site knows how I feel about Lentz guitars. Scott and Scotty are among the best builders out there right now IMHO. This Tele-style instrument is a perfect example. This Swamp Ash Sonic Blue baby weighs just 6.2 pounds and rings like a bell. The neck is a large soft V to C shape measuring .880" at the first fret increasing to 1.0" at the twelfth fret and it feels superb in your hand. The 9.5" radius fret board is a beautifully dark rosewood with 6105 frets and clay dots.The nut is bone and 1.670" wide. The original owner of this instrument improved on what was already a great instrument by having Ron Ellis Mid-Tall B'Caster pickups, a Rutters control plate and Rutters saddles professionally installed (sorry, but I don't have the original parts). This guitar is in great condition with just one exception, that being a ding (pictured) near the imput jack. This flaw aside, this guitar is in near new condition and were it not for this cosmetic issue, I would be charging several hundred dollars more for this incredible piece. It comes with it's original blonde G&G case in exceptional conditon. Do yourself a favor and try a Lentz hand-built instrument. You will be very glad you did!
